      More about IMANU

      Overview of Drum & Bass musician IMANU

      IMANU is a Rotterdam-born Dutch electronic music performer. While there are elements of many different genres in his music, he is best renowned for his contributions to the drum and bass subgenre. IMANU has carved out a separate niche for himself in the electronic music field with a style that is both experimental and sophisticated.

      His work is distinguished by an extensive use of drums, sophisticated melodies, and innovative sound design. IMANU is a popular among listeners of electronic music because of his sound, which is both energizing and boundary-pushing. His songs frequently contain a lot of emotionally charged language that engages the listener with a sense of urgency and intensity.

      IMANU has a devoted following because of his distinctive voice and his obvious commitment to his art. IMANU is a rising star in the drum and bass genre and someone who electronic music fans should keep an eye on because of his dedication to expanding the frontiers of electronic music.

      What are the latest songs and music albums for Drum & Bass musician IMANU?

      With his most recent releases, Rotterdam, Netherlands-based electronic and drum & bass music producer IMANU has been creating waves in the music business. "UNFOLD Remixes (2023)" is his most recent album, and it is a collection of fresh interpretations of "Unfold (2022)". The remixes, created by a variety of musicians, highlight IMANU's work's originality and adaptability.

      IMANU released an album of remixes as well as a number of singles in 2023. IMANU collaborates with the British grime musician Flowdan on the upbeat and gritty song "Outlaw (feat. Flowdan)". "Pillow Talk (yunis Remix)" gives the original tune a more ethereal, dreamlike tone, while "Shoyu (Deadcrow Remix)" gives it a darker, more atmospheric sound. Last but not least, "Temper (Former Remix)" gives the original tune a harder, more aggressive edge.

      Recent works by IMANU show his capacity to vary with sound and genre while retaining his distinctive approach. IMANU will soon release more thrilling and avant-garde music, which fans of electronic and drum & bass music can look forward to.
